Output 940e23a46686a6a95d936b0bcc90d9a85ee52a80dfbb84e43368e2213ca626d3:1

value
74126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8c757c9f18a2a4abbea4bda6304d85362dd36b OP_EQUAL
address
3En2pEUu4ryHh5rzzXFsSGwRcqLLzCmhWa
transaction
940e23a46686a6a95d936b0bcc90d9a85ee52a80dfbb84e43368e2213ca626d3